Transaction 7bf784e3c46058f2ef2890ffd8907fd90327a13445c04df19a709d4e8bae29d3
1 Input
1 Output
-
7bf784e3c46058f2ef2890ffd8907fd90327a13445c04df19a709d4e8bae29d3:0
- value
- 308535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 504201097247d5c7d1535a52bfedd49f5dd99c87 OP_EQUAL
- address
- 391P3w1XTLh793PfQDvWWvEYGL1SdiiuPQ